左右滑动切换是几乎所有应用中都会用到的功能。在这里将相关资源进行总结

(1)viewflipper结合手势检测进行左右滑动。

http://www.cnblogs.com/hanyonglu/archive/2012/02/13/2349827.html

这种方法很简单,但是大概效果不是很理想(不过自己感觉还行)。具体的改进网上资源有很多,可以在用到的时候再搜索

(2)viewflipper渐显按钮实现图片切换。

http://www.cnblogs.com/hanyonglu/archive/2012/02/13/2350171.html

这个示例中实现了,当按下屏幕时候,出现向左向右两个按钮,点击对应按钮实现图片向左或者向右切换。当松开屏幕时候,按钮消失。

这种方法使用到了windowmanager记得在配置文件中添加权限:

<uses-permission android:name="android.permission.SYSTEM_ALERT_WINDOW" />
 <uses-permission android:name="android.permission.SYSTEM_OVERLAY_WINDOW" />

(3)viewPager实现带有底部圆点指引效果的滑动效果。

http://www.cnblogs.com/hanyonglu/archive/2012/04/07/2435589.html

(4)viewPaper实现局部图片的滑动效果(viewpager非标准库,而是一个ui支持库)。

http://www.cnblogs.com/hanyonglu/archive/2012/06/19/2555113.html

(5)有时间的话研究一下,这几种滑动的区别

gallery,scrollview,viewflipper,viewpaper,viewflow。

(6)实现导航菜单的滑动效果

http://www.cnblogs.com/hanyonglu/archive/2012/04/21/2462311.html

最新文章

  1. spring boot整合shiro出现UnavailableSecurityManagerException
  2. Chrome开发者工具不完全指南(五、移动篇)
  3. poj1012
  4. SequoiaDB创始人:比MongoDB领先一到两年 打造企业级NoSQL数据库
  5. springboot工程读取配置文件application.yml的写法
  6. Android Map新用法:MapFragment应用
  7. spring与hibernate整合事务管理的理解
  8. Java Date 和 Calendar
  9. android 使用 service 实现音乐
  10. hql中的in查询
  11. 将Excel文件数据导入到SqlServer数据库的三种方案
  12. DOM操作中,getElementByXXXX 和 querySelector 的区别
  13. 第三章Hibernate关联映射
  14. IDEA汉化教程
  15. 当yum安装出现Error: Package: glibc-headers .....时
  16. Texture转Texture2D
  17. TensorFlow——循环神经网络基本结构
  18. springboot03-unittest mockmvc单元测试
  19. Emmet.vim 教程
  20. Intent 跳转Activity

热门文章

  1. CF 631B 题解
  2. js知识点——1
  3. gcc数据对齐之: howto 2.
  4. 关于js计算非等宽字体宽度的方法
  5. volatile关键字?MESI协议?指令重排?内存屏障?这都是啥玩意
  6. __main__ 变量
  7. 使用Vim打开十六进制的文件
  8. 使用layer弹窗和layui表单做新增功能
  9. SQLite3中自增主键相关知识总结,清零的方法、INTEGER PRIMARY KEY AUTOINCREMENT和rowid的使用
  10. laravel查询数据库获取结果如何判断是否为空?